Overview
D20V0S1U2LP20-7 from Diodes Incorporated is a single-channel, ultra-low-capacitance TVS diode designed for ESD protection of high-speed data lines in portable electronics. It features a 20 V reverse standoff voltage, ±30 kV IEC 61000-4-2 contact/air ESD rating, 120 A peak pulse current (8/20 µs), and 880 pF channel input capacitance - optimized for USB 2.0, HDMI, and audio interfaces in smartphones and digital cameras.
For engineers reviewing the D20V0S1U2LP20-7 datasheet, D20V0S1U2LP20-7 pinout, D20V0S1U2LP20-7 application, or D20V0S1U2LP20-7 equivalent, key selection criteria include clamping voltage at 120 A (37.0 V), low leakage (200 nA @ 20 V), U-DFN2020-2 package footprint, and compliance with RoHS 3, halogen-free, and antimony-free "Green" standards.
Technical Context
This TVS diode operates as a unidirectional transient suppressor with cathode-anode polarity, triggered by reverse-biased avalanche breakdown above 22 V (VBR min). Its low 880 pF capacitance ensures minimal signal distortion on high-frequency I/O lines up to 480 Mbps (USB 2.0).
The device uses a silicon planar construction in a lead-free U-DFN2020-2 package with NiPdAu-plated terminals, enabling reflow compatibility and meeting J-STD-020 Level 1 moisture sensitivity. Thermal resistance is 250 °C/W (junction-to-ambient, FR-4 board), supporting continuous 500 mW power dissipation.

Pinout & Package
U-DFN2020-2 is a 2-terminal, bottom-terminated surface-mount package with exposed thermal pad (not electrically connected). Pin 1 is anode; Pin 2 is cathode (marked with dot). The device is unidirectional and must be oriented with cathode toward the protected line's positive rail.
| Pin/Terminal | Circuit Role | Design Meaning |
|---|---|---|
| Pin 1 (Anode) | Input/Line Terminal | Connected to signal line requiring ESD protection; conducts surge current to ground when clamped. |
| Pin 2 (Cathode) | Ground Reference | Connected to system ground plane; establishes reference for avalanche breakdown and defines clamping polarity. |

FAQ
What is the polarity configuration of D20V0S1U2LP20-7?
D20V0S1U2LP20-7 is a unidirectional TVS diode with anode (Pin 1) and cathode (Pin 2) terminals. It conducts only during reverse-biased transients - i.e., when the cathode voltage exceeds the anode by ≥22 V. This configuration protects positive-rail-referenced signal lines such as USB D+ and HDMI TMDS+.
Does D20V0S1U2LP20-7 meet automotive AEC-Q200 requirements?
No. D20V0S1U2LP20-7 is qualified for commercial and industrial temperature ranges (–65 °C to +150 °C) but has not undergone AEC-Q200 stress testing. For automotive infotainment or ADAS applications, Diodes' AEC-Q200-qualified APxxxx series TVS devices should be used instead.
Can this device protect bidirectional data lines like I²C without additional components?
No. As a unidirectional device, D20V0S1U2LP20-7 only clamps negative transients relative to ground. For true bidirectional protection (e.g., I²C SDA/SCL), two devices in back-to-back configuration or a dedicated bidirectional TVS such as D24V0L1B2LP20-7 are required.
What is the maximum recommended PCB trace length between D20V0S1U2LP20-7 and the protected connector?
Per IEC 61000-4-2 layout guidance, the trace from the TVS cathode to the system ground plane must be ≤3 mm, and the distance from the protected line to the TVS anode must be ≤5 mm. Longer traces increase inductance, raising clamping voltage during fast ESD events and degrading protection effectiveness.
